Title              :

Tidal Love Numbers of Black Holes

Speaker         : Chiranjeeb Singha, IUCAA Pune
Date                : September 10, 2026
Time               : 3:30 PM
Venue            : Seminar room 3307
Abstract        :

 In this talk, I will first discuss the tidal response of rotating BTZ black holes to scalar perturbations. I will show that the real part of the response function is non-zero, leading to finite tidal Love numbers (TLNs). The response also exhibits scale-dependent logarithmic running. I will further discuss the qualitatively similar behaviour of extremal rotating BTZ black holes and outline a procedure for computing the tidal response of charged rotating BTZ spacetimes. Motivated by the vanishing of static TLNs for four-dimensional vacuum black holes in general relativity, I will then explore tidal deformation in higher-curvature theories of gravity. In pure Lovelock gravity, static TLNs vanish in certain cases, extending the four-dimensional result to specific higher-dimensional scenarios. In contrast, black holes in Einstein–Gauss–Bonnet gravity generally possess non-zero TLNs, whose magnitude depends on the Gauss–Bonnet coupling. These results highlight the strong dependence of black-hole tidal response on both spacetime dimensionality and the underlying theory of gravity.
